There are four types of mesothelioma lawsuits that include personal injury lawsuits; wrongful-death lawsuits asbestos trust fund claims; and mesothelioma VA lawsuits. Personal injury lawsuits are filed by victims of mesothelioma, or their family members who survived to obtain financial compensation from the companies responsible for their asbestos exposure. In the case of wrongful death, lawsuits are filed by family members of victims who have died as a result of asbestos exposure, and these lawsuits are filed on behalf of the estate of the victim.

Asbestos trusts are formed by asbestos companies that have been bankrupted or dissolved to pay claims for asbestos-related illnesses. Settlements or jury awards are usually used to resolve these claims. Additionally, mesothelioma VA benefits are available to veterans of the military who are diagnosed with an asbestos settlement-related illness like mesothelioma.
